First of all, the Go language is increasingly used in the field of cloud computing. Due to its high degree of concurrency, the Go language is ideal for building cloud-native applications. Developers can use the Go language to write efficient concurrent code and effectively manage large-scale cloud infrastructure. The following is a simple concurrent code example:
package main import ( "fmt" "sync" ) func main() { var wg sync.WaitGroup wg.Add(2) go func() { defer wg.Done() for i := 1; i <= 5; i++ { fmt.Printf("Goroutine 1: %d ", i) } }() go func() { defer wg.Done() for i := 1; i <= 5; i++ { fmt.Printf("Goroutine 2: %d ", i) } }() wg.Wait() fmt.Println("All goroutines finished executing.") }
In the above example, we use the go
keyword of the Go language to execute tasks concurrently, using sync.WaitGroup
Wait for all concurrent tasks to complete. By running the above code, we can see that two goroutines are outputting numbers in sequence concurrently.
Secondly, Go language also has excellent performance in the field of network programming. Developers can use Go language to quickly build high-performance network services, such as web services and microservices. The following is a simple HTTP server example:
package main import ( "fmt" "log" "net/http" ) func helloHandler(w http.ResponseWriter, r *http.Request) { fmt.Fprintf(w, "Hello, World!") } func main() { http.HandleFunc("/", helloHandler) log.Fatal(http.ListenAndServe(":8080", nil)) }
In the above example, we use the http.HandleFunc
function to register a helloHandler
function as the handler function of the root path . By running the above code, we can start a simple HTTP server on local port 8080. When we visit http://localhost:8080/
, the server will return "Hello, World!".
In addition to cloud computing and network programming, the Go language has also been widely used in the field of container technology. The underlying implementation of container platforms such as Docker is written in the Go language. The lightweight coroutine and efficient scheduling mechanism of Go language make the creation and management of containers more efficient. The following is a simple containerization example:
package main import ( "fmt" "os" "os/exec" "syscall" ) func main() { cmd := exec.Command("/bin/sh") cmd.SysProcAttr = &syscall.SysProcAttr{ Cloneflags: syscall.CLONE_NEWUTS | syscall.CLONE_NEWPID | syscall.CLONE_NEWNS, } cmd.Stdin = os.Stdin cmd.Stdout = os.Stdout cmd.Stderr = os.Stderr if err := cmd.Run(); err != nil { fmt.Println("Error:", err) } }
In the above example, we created a new process using the os/exec
package of the Go language. By setting the Cloneflags
field of SysProcAttr
, we achieve isolation of the UTS and PID namespaces, thereby creating a simple container.
